Starting your day with a visit to the Chengdu Panda Breeding Research Base is a highlight. From the moment you step into this lush garden-like setting, it’s clear why pandas have become an international symbol of conservation and charm. The guide, often someone like Liu or Wei, will meet you at your hotel, making introductions and setting expectations before transferring you to the panda sanctuary.
Once inside, you’ll be greeted by the sight of adorable panda babies drinking milk, munching bamboo, or napping in the shade. These little bundles of fluff are even more endearing in person than photos suggest, and you’ll appreciate the open enclosures that mimic their natural habitat, allowing for some wonderful photo opportunities and close-up views. The area is spacious, with bamboo groves and a small lake creating a peaceful environment—perfect for leisurely observation.
The teenage pandas are particularly fun to watch; they seem to have boundless energy, climbing trees or play-fighting in their enclosures. Visitors have noted how well-maintained and clean the grounds are, adding to the overall positive impression. Besides giant pandas, red pandas also make an appearance, with their striking red fur and long tails entertaining visitors in the same lush setting.
Travel tip: We loved the way the guide explained panda behaviors and conservation efforts—adding depth to the visit beyond just snapping photos. Expect about 3 hours here, giving ample time for photos, questions, and soaking in the adorable scene.
After bidding farewell to the pandas, you’ll hop on a high-speed train to Leshan, which shortens what could be a long drive into an efficient, scenic one-hour ride. The train line offers a peek into everyday Chinese life—locals commuting, farmers tending fields, and children heading home from school.
The landscape varies seasonally: in spring, fields burst with yellow rapeseed flowers; in summer, vibrant green rice paddies stretch into the horizon; and autumn brings golden harvest scenes. The train ride itself is a highlight for many travelers, providing a relaxing break and stunning views.
Upon arrival, you’ll enjoy a local Sichuan-style lunch—with options for non-spicy and vegetarian dishes, ensuring everyone has a satisfying meal. Post-lunch, the highlight is the river cruise, taking you to the confluence of three rivers where the Leshan Giant Buddha looms majestically. This 71-meter-tall stone sculpture, carved into a cliff face, is a marvel of ancient engineering, with a history dating back over a millennium.
The cruise offers a panoramic view of the Buddha, with the river flowing tranquilly below. Many reviewers mention that the views are absolutely breathtaking—”the sight of the Buddha with the river swirling around is truly mesmerizing,” one traveler noted. The cruise also provides a different perspective from the land-based viewing areas, allowing for stellar photos.

What’s included in the tour?
The tour includes entrance fees for the panda base, a river cruise ticket for the Leshan Buddha, lunch, high-speed train tickets, and private transportation between all locations.
How long is the train ride?
The train ride from Chengdu to Leshan lasts approximately one hour, offering scenic views along the way.
Can the lunch be customized?
Yes, the tour offers options for non-spicy and vegetarian dishes, ensuring dietary preferences are accommodated.
Is this tour suitable for families?
Given its structured itinerary and accessible sites, it works well for families, though younger children should be comfortable with the pace and outdoor activities.
What if the weather is bad?
Since the experience is weather-dependent, poor weather may lead to cancellations or rescheduling, but you’ll be offered an alternative date or a full refund.
How much free time is there at each site?
You’ll have about 3 hours at the panda base and 3 hours for the Leshan Buddha and local exploration, providing enough time to see the highlights but not extended exploration.
